Commercial Exterior Painting in Longmont, CO
Commercial exterior painting services involve applying high-quality paint to the outside surfaces of commercial buildings, including storefronts, office complexes, warehouses, and industrial facilities. This service helps enhance curb appeal, provides protection against weather elements, and maintains the building’s structural integrity. Projects can range from small storefronts to large multi-story buildings, and often include surface preparation, such as cleaning and repairing damaged areas, to ensure a smooth and long-lasting finish. Property owners typically want to understand the scope of work, the types of finishes available, and how the process can help preserve their investment over time.
Before requesting commercial exterior painting, property owners should consider factors such as the current condition of the building’s exterior, the desired appearance, and any specific durability requirements. It’s also helpful to inquire about surface preparation procedures, weather considerations, and the types of paint or coatings recommended for their building’s material and exposure conditions. Clarifying these details can ensure the project meets expectations and results in a durable, visually appealing exterior that withstands local weather conditions.

Commercial Exterior Painting Questions
What types of exterior surfaces can be painted? Exterior painting services typically include surfaces such as wood, stucco, brick, and metal on commercial buildings.
Are there specific preparations needed before painting? Proper cleaning, surface repairs, and sometimes primer application are essential to ensure a durable and even finish.
Can exterior painting help improve the appearance of a commercial property? Yes, a fresh coat of paint can enhance curb appeal and give the property a well-maintained look.
What are common projects for exterior painting services? Projects often include repainting building facades, trim, doors, and outdoor signage or fixtures.
